Considered as one of the wealthiest persons in Israel today, Idan Ofer is an Israeli businessman with an estimated net worth of $4.1 billion as of April 2016, according to Forbes. Most of his net worth is derived from his shipping and drilling business which he inherited from his billionaire father Sammy Ofer who was also considered as a shipping magnate before his death in 2011.

Today, Idan Ofer heads Quantum Pacific Group which holds interests in Pacific Drilling SA. This company went public on the New York Stock Exchange just last year. Quantum Pacific Group also has interests in Israel Corporation which is considered as the largest public holding company on Tel Aviv Stock Exchange. Idan Ofer also sits as the Chairman of Better Place, an electric car fueling station based in Silicon Valley. Together with his brother Eyal, Idan Ofer also owns Zim Integrated Shipping Services which is considered as one of the world's most wide reaching shipping companies.
